TL;DR Summary

The United States and Iran carried out tit-for-tat strikes overnight—U.S. forces hit an Iranian launch site in Bandar Abbas after downing five drones, Iran retaliated by targeting a U.S. base in Kuwait—testing a fragile ceasefire and complicating ongoing negotiations for a broader peace deal tied to Iran’s nuclear program. President Trump said there’s no pressure to strike a deal, and oil prices rose amid the flare‑up.
